WebAug 1, 2024 · Third-party data is information aggregated and sold by an entity without a direct relationship with a consumer. Data vendors compile massive databases of information about consumers from many different sources—public records, credit reporting agencies, etc.—and combine it with data inferred from online behavior.

But a field whose data type is Number can store only numerical data. So, you have to know what properties are … chinese art 16th centuryWebAll data types include the null value. Distinct from all nonnull values, the null value is a special value that denotes the absence of a (nonnull) value.
